A rescue helicopter lifts a 75 kilogram person straight up by means of a cable. The person has an upward acceleration of 0.70 m/s2 and is lifted from rest through a distance of 12 meter.

(a) Determine what is the tension in the cable?

N

(b) Determine how much work is done by the tension in the cable?

J

(c) Determine how much work is done by the person's weight?

J

(d) Use the work-energy theorem and determine the final speed of the person.

m/s
